About Thebarton 5031

The size of Thebarton is approximately 1.2 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 1.9% of total area. The population of Thebarton in 2016 was 1431 people. By 2021 the population was 1442 showing a population growth of 0.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Thebarton is 20-29 years. Households in Thebarton are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Thebarton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 49.80% of the homes in Thebarton were owner-occupied compared with 48.90% in 2016.

Thebarton has 1,106 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Thebarton have seen a 81.25%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 83.16% increase. As at 31 October 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Thebarton is $1,076,421 while the median value for Units is $696,827.
  • Houses have a median rent of $648 while Units have a median rent of $468.
